Words of Life - John 6:68
I'm sure you all have heard and even said, as a kid, "Sticks and stones will break my bones but words will never harm me". This was a clever come back to those who were calling us names but the fact is it's
just not true. Words harm people every day. Many hardened criminals testify that they were told repeatedly that they were no good by a parent or someone in authority. There is a preponderance of evidence that negative words have destroyed the self image of millions of people. On the other hand there is evidence that positive words have lifted up young people who have gone on to accomplish great things.

Our lead scripture from John 6:68 says: Simon Peter answered him, Lord, to whom shall we go? Thou hast the words of eternal life.Peter was referring to the words of confession unto salvation that Jesus is Lord and the word "life" in the Gree k is "Zoe" or God's kind of life and even everything that makes God, God. He is life. The point I want to focus upon here is "Words". Words can get you saved and words can get you healed and words ca n make you prosperous.
Those who doubt this will quickly say "There you go, joining the 'name it and claim it' crowd". This may also be a cute saying but the Bible confirms over and over that we have what we say. Mark 11:23,24 - 23For verily I say unto you, That whosoever shall say unto this mountain, Be thou removed, and be thou cast into the sea; and shall not doubt in his heart, but shall believe that those things which he saith shall come to pass; he shall have whatsoever he saith. 24Therefore I say unto you, what things soever ye desire, when ye pray, believe that ye receive them, and ye shall have them.
Jesus did not waste words and these words from Mark are so powerful that I am amazed that anyone would ignore them. I heard Kenneth Copeland say the other day "The universe is a word created and a
word governed system". Did not God say "Let there be light and light was"? Yes he did and that's how the universe was created, through words. God made man in his image, (the exact likeness) and we were created to "walk and talk and act like Jesus".
An important thing to remember is that words can tear down and also build up. It's not just a single word that alters your circumstances and creates your future. It's what you say repeatedly that establishes direction. Have you ever heard a person say
repeatedly "I usually catch the flu every year about this time" and sure enough they do? Then they laugh it off and say "I told you so", not knowing that their words helped to afflict them. I have a friend who used to say regularly "That about gave me a heart attack". Sure enough, he had a heart attack and now takes medication for it. Don't think you can ignore the principles of God and get by with it.
God designed words to help us accomplish what He wants for us and for what is good for us, but the devil tricks us into using our own against us. Then he conceals what we said and when we said negative words so that we aren't even aware what we have been saying.
Click: James 3:3-6 and read carefully, especially verse 6 The tongue also is a fire, a w
orld of evil among the parts of the body. It corru pts the whole person, sets the whole course of his life on fire, and is itself set on fire by hell. So now that you know you can go out and speak words of life. Huaa!
